Jane Jenkins Stephens

October 1, 1920 — July 27, 2009

Jane Ellen Jenkins Stephens of Snellville, GA, formerly of Lilburn, GA went to be with her Lord on Monday, July 27, 2009.  Mrs. Stephens was born October 1, 1920 in Atlanta, GA and was the daughter of William Robert Jenkins, Sr. and Ella Norton Jenkins.  She graduated from Decatur High School on June 3, 1939 and married the love of her life, Tillman Stephens, that same night.  They were married for 67 happy years until his death in 2006.  In addition to her husband and parents, she was predeceased by her baby sister, Emily Sue Jenkins, in 1928.  She is survived by her children; Betty Ann Summerford of Snellville and Riley and Becky Stephens of Tucker; grandchildren: Cindy Stephens, Jeanne and Ashton Cary, Rilo and Wanda Stephens; great grandchildren: Stephen and John Cary, Patrick and Elizabeth Stephens; brother and sister-in-law Robert and Diane Jenkins along with many nieces, nephews and other relatives. Jane Ellen was an outstanding homemaker and fine Christian example to her family and friends.  She was a true helpmate to husband Tillman and a tireless worker in the community and church.  Together they helped found Lilburn Alliance Church, which first met in their home.  She remained a faithful member until her death.
